About the role

The Branch Supervisor is responsible for supporting the day-to-day running of the branch, ensuring excellent customer service, safe operations, strong team performance and achievement of sales and operational targets. The role involves supervising staff, maintaining stock control and helping create an efficient, customer-focused branch environment.    Salary: Up to £35,000 DOE    Key Responsibilities Operations & Branch Performance Support the Branch Manager in the daily operation of the branch. Ensure smooth running of trade counter, warehouse and yard activities. Help achieve branch sales and profitability targets. Monitor stock levels and ensure accurate stock control procedures. Ensure goods are received, stored and dispatched correctly. Maintain high standards of housekeeping throughout the branch. Team Supervision Supervise branch staff and provide day-to-day guidance. Assist with staff training, development and performance management. Support rota planning and workload allocation. Promote a positive and professional team culture. Customer Service Deliver excellent customer service to trade and retail customers. Handle customer queries, complaints and escalations professionally. Build strong relationships with local contractors and account customers. Support upselling and cross-selling opportunities. Health & Safety Ensure compliance with company health & safety procedures. Promote safe working practices across the branch. Conduct regular safety checks and report hazards promptly. Ensure correct use of PPE and equipment. Administration Complete branch paperwork and operational reporting accurately. Support cash handling and banking procedures where required. Assist with ordering, invoicing and supplier coordination. Skills & Experience Required Previous experience within a builder’s merchant, trade supply, or wholesale environment. Experience supervising or leading a team. Strong customer service skills. Good communication and organisational abilities. Knowledge of stock control and warehouse operations. Ability to work in a fast-paced environment
